In Russia, they complain that they are fighting against a well-armed army.
The mayor of Moscow, Serhii Sobyanin, who is also the head of the State Council commission that coordinates the work of the regions to increase the level of security, admitted that Russia is “essentially” fighting in Ukraine, but not against the Armed Forces. A Russian official said that Putin’s army “opposes the entire NATO bloc.”
This is what the mayor of Moscow said said in an interview with the TVC channel, Kremlin propaganda media write.
“Russia is currently opposing the entire NATO bloc in Ukraine, where, in fact, there is a war. A special military operation is being conducted in Ukraine, in fact, there is a war there, what is there to hide. But we are not at war with Ukraine, the whole of NATO is behind it with with all its technologies, weapons, information, special weapons, special technologies,” Sobyanin said.
It will be recalled that on December 7, Russian “Fuhrer” Vladimir Putin called the war in Ukraine a “war” for the first time. Moreover, he accused Ukraine of “ignoring Russia’s interests in protecting the Russian-speaking population of Donbas.” And also stated that the so-called “SVO” can drag on for a long time.
